Keeping exotic pets can pose several challenges due to their unique care requirements, potential health issues, legal restrictions, and limited availability of specialized veterinary care. Some common challenges include:

  1. Specialized care needs: Exotic pets often have specific dietary, environmental, and social requirements that can be difficult to meet in a home setting.

  2. Health issues: Exotic pets may be more prone to certain health problems or diseases that are not commonly seen in traditional pets. Finding a veterinarian with expertise in exotic animal care can be challenging.

  3. Legal restrictions: Many exotic species are subject to strict regulations regarding ownership, breeding, and transportation. Owners may need permits or licenses to keep certain types of exotic pets legally.

  4. Cost of care: Exotic pets can be expensive to care for due to the need for specialized equipment, food, and veterinary care. Emergency medical treatment for exotic animals can also come at a high cost.

  5. Longevity and commitment: Some exotic pets have long lifespans and may require a lifelong commitment from their owners. Before acquiring an exotic pet, potential owners should consider whether they can provide care for the pet for its entire lifespan.

Overall, keeping exotic pets requires extensive research, dedication, and resources to ensure the well-being of the animals and compliance with legal regulations.
